This doc is absolutely terrible. It’s suppose to cover ‘the boy band scam’ however up until half way through the series the topic is merely brushed over.

Half way through the series and they have basically only covered completely random points. The first episode spends a lot of time covering back stories, of Lou mixed with random stories about him with little evidence, no real point to these stories. Many make him out to be this great guy.. His childhood friend that was fawning over him making fake ID was particularly bad. They talk about previous scams but with no proof and no real judgement on what ended up happening. Did he maybe rip those people off? Wink and a nod.. In a documentary? So realistically they don’t cover a single backstory well, they all feel ‘touched upon’, and the information they do focus on is incomplete and without a point really.

They cover the backstory of the two most famous bands he is affiliated with but in a very poor way. They cover certain artists backstories but not others. The impression I got was that they are really trying to make these boy bands out to be the biggest losers ever. Obviously boy bands did not age well.. but it’s like they selected the most cringe worthy clips surrounding boy bands to really hammer the point home. You get the feeling of ‘why were these dorks even popular’, whereas there is surely some more flattering clips of them out there. They never really cover their rise to super stardom or really show what that super stardom even looked like. They’re talking about sums of $200M but haven’t or have barely even showed them performing sold out arenas. Like where did that money come from? You never showed the ‘rise’ part.

Then they talk about how Lou was screwing them in the most traditional way every manager screws their artists.. Their really is not a single ‘scam’ that was talked about, unless they’re waiting right until the end to disclose it. An episode an a half in and their isn’t a single point of how Lou is doing anything ‘different’. What Ponzi scheme?

After Lou and the bands settles in court, it shows Lou in an interview saying these boy bands needed him, that he built them – That they couldn’t do it on their own. Scene jumps to several members scoffing at the idea until one jokingly says ‘except for justin timberlake’ who literally was the only one of the dozens of members that ever had a successful solo career. It’s probably the highlight of irony in this show. I don’t even know the names of the guys that are responding to the comment, that is how right Lou was.

Even many comments directly relate Lou and his antics to the Beatles but then never make any mention of it. Examples being: Starting their careers in Germany, referring to himself as the 6th member and others.

The only thing that seemed to be news was Lou Pearlmans previous business venture and more specifically his desire to work with a former Nazi. That story was basically the problem with this documentary in a nutshell. “We heard he got insurance money” “He moved to florida after”. Like zero completion to the story, zero confirmation any scam took place, and just conjecture about why he would have done what they haven’t proven he did..
